How to Optimize Back-End Security With HTTPS and SSL
In today's digital landscape, ensuring the security of your website is not just a best practice; it's a necessity. One of the most vital elements in back-end security is the implementation of HTTPS and SSL certificates. Understanding how to effectively optimize these elements can significantly enhance your website's security and contribute positively to your SEO rankings.
What Are HTTPS and SSL?
HTTPS stands for HyperText Transfer Protocol Secure, while SSL, or Secure Sockets Layer, is a protocol used to secure communication between a web browser and a server. When a site uses HTTPS, it encrypts the data transmitted between the user's browser and the server, providing a critical layer of security.
Why Implement HTTPS and SSL?
There are several compelling reasons for optimizing back-end security with HTTPS and SSL:
- Enhanced Security: An SSL certificate encrypts sensitive information, like login credentials and payment details, reducing the risk of data breaches.
- Improved SEO Ranking: Google's algorithms favor secure websites, meaning switching to HTTPS can positively impact your search engine visibility.
- User Trust: Seeing the padlock symbol in the address bar gives users confidence that their data is secure, leading to higher conversion rates.
Steps to Optimize Back-End Security with HTTPS and SSL
1. Acquire an SSL Certificate:
The first step is to purchase an SSL certificate from a trusted certificate authority (CA). There are various types available, including domain-validated, organization-validated, and extended-validation certificates. Choose one that suits the needs of your website.
2. Install the SSL Certificate:
Once you've obtained your SSL certificate, install it on your web server. This process varies depending on your hosting provider, so consult their documentation or customer support for assistance.
3. Redirect HTTP to HTTPS:
After installation, set up 301 redirects from HTTP to HTTPS. This ensures that users and search engines are directed to the secure version of your site. Update internal links to point to HTTPS and double-check your robots.txt and sitemap files to reflect the new URLs.
4. Update Your Content Management System (CMS):
If you're using a CMS like WordPress, ensure that it recognizes the SSL certificate. Some plugins can help manage the transition to HTTPS, making the process smoother and easier.
5. Test Your Implementation:
After making changes, thoroughly test your website for any mixed content issues. Mixed content occurs when a secure HTTPS page includes resources that are loaded over an unsecure HTTP connection. Use browser developer tools or various online tools to identify and fix these issues.
6. Monitor Your Site's Performance:
After optimizing your website for HTTPS, continuously monitor its performance. Look for any drops in traffic or SEO rankings. Tools like Google Search Console can provide insights into how the transition is impacting your site.
Conclusion
Optimizing back-end security through HTTPS and SSL is essential for safeguarding user data and enhancing your website's credibility. Not only does it protect your site from potential security threats, but it also plays a crucial role in improving your search engine rankings. By following the steps outlined above, you can ensure a secure and trustworthy online presence that will benefit both your users and your business.